Raised on a council estate situated in a former mining town in Nottinghamshire (UK) throughout the 1970s and 1980s, Brett Gregory is a former lecturer in Film and Cultural Studies who has been writing, directing, editing and producing films in Manchester (UK) since 2005. His filmography includes the independent music documentaries 'Iceland: Beyond Sigur Rós' (2010), 'Manchester: Beyond Oasis' (2012) and 'Liverpool: Beyond The Beatles' (2015), as well as his critically acclaimed, multi-award winning working-class feature film, 'Nobody Loves You and You Don't Deserve to Exist' (2022). From June 2023 he occupied the UK Desk (Film and Culture) for the weekly arts and culture radio show, Arts Express, on WBAI 99.5 FM in New York (US). In February 2024 he was then appointed as an Associate Editor (Film, Culture, and Academia) for the UK arts, culture and politics website, Culture Matters. In turn, he is also the founder and editor of Serious Feather, an independent, non-profit review, interview, and discussion website for academics, authors, and artists, with its associated podcast, Serious Feather Arts.
